- /* mdb_load.c - memory-mapped database load tool */
- /*
- * Copyright 2011-2021 Howard Chu, Symas Corp.
- * All rights reserved.
- *
- * Redistribution and use in source and binary forms, with or without
- * modification, are permitted only as authorized by the OpenLDAP
- * Public License.
- *
- * A copy of this license is available in the file LICENSE in the
- * top-level directory of the distribution or, alternatively, at
- * <http://www.OpenLDAP.org/license.html>.
- */
- #include <stdio.h>
- #include <stdlib.h>
- #include <errno.h>
- #include <string.h>
- #include <ctype.h>
- #include <unistd.h>
- #include "lmdb.h"
- #define PRINT 1
- #define NOHDR 2
- static int mode;
- static char *subname = NULL;
- static size_t lineno;
- static int version;
- static int flags;
- static char *prog;
- static int Eof;
- static MDB_envinfo info;
- static MDB_val kbuf, dbuf;
- static MDB_val k0buf;
- #ifdef _WIN32
- #define Z "I"
- #else
- #define Z "z"
- #endif
- #define STRLENOF(s) (sizeof(s)-1)
- typedef struct flagbit {
- int bit;
- char *name;
- int len;
- } flagbit;
- #define S(s) s, STRLENOF(s)
- flagbit dbflags[] = {
- { MDB_REVERSEKEY, S("reversekey") },
- { MDB_DUPSORT, S("dupsort") },
- { MDB_INTEGERKEY, S("integerkey") },
- { MDB_DUPFIXED, S("dupfixed") },
- { MDB_INTEGERDUP, S("integerdup") },
- { MDB_REVERSEDUP, S("reversedup") },
- { 0, NULL, 0 }
- };
- static void readhdr(void)
- {
- char *ptr;
- flags = 0;
- while (fgets(dbuf.mv_data, dbuf.mv_size, stdin) != NULL) {
- lineno++;
- if (!strncmp(dbuf.mv_data, "VERSION=", STRLENOF("VERSION="))) {
- version=atoi((char *)dbuf.mv_data+STRLENOF("VERSION="));
- if (version > 3) {
- fprintf(stderr, "%s: line %" Z "d: unsupported VERSION %d\n",
- prog, lineno, version);
- exit(EXIT_FAILURE);
- }
- } else if (!strncmp(dbuf.mv_data, "HEADER=END", STRLENOF("HEADER=END"))) {
- break;
- } else if (!strncmp(dbuf.mv_data, "format=", STRLENOF("format="))) {
- if (!strncmp((char *)dbuf.mv_data+STRLENOF("FORMAT="), "print", STRLENOF("print")))
- mode |= PRINT;
- else if (strncmp((char *)dbuf.mv_data+STRLENOF("FORMAT="), "bytevalue", STRLENOF("bytevalue"))) {
- fprintf(stderr, "%s: line %" Z "d: unsupported FORMAT %s\n",
- prog, lineno, (char *)dbuf.mv_data+STRLENOF("FORMAT="));
- exit(EXIT_FAILURE);
- }
- } else if (!strncmp(dbuf.mv_data, "database=", STRLENOF("database="))) {
- ptr = memchr(dbuf.mv_data, '\n', dbuf.mv_size);
- if (ptr) *ptr = '\0';
- if (subname) free(subname);
- subname = strdup((char *)dbuf.mv_data+STRLENOF("database="));
- } else if (!strncmp(dbuf.mv_data, "type=", STRLENOF("type="))) {
- if (strncmp((char *)dbuf.mv_data+STRLENOF("type="), "btree", STRLENOF("btree"))) {
- fprintf(stderr, "%s: line %" Z "d: unsupported type %s\n",
- prog, lineno, (char *)dbuf.mv_data+STRLENOF("type="));
- exit(EXIT_FAILURE);
- }
- } else if (!strncmp(dbuf.mv_data, "mapaddr=", STRLENOF("mapaddr="))) {
- int i;
- ptr = memchr(dbuf.mv_data, '\n', dbuf.mv_size);
- if (ptr) *ptr = '\0';
- i = sscanf((char *)dbuf.mv_data+STRLENOF("mapaddr="), "%p", &info.me_mapaddr);
- if (i != 1) {
- fprintf(stderr, "%s: line %" Z "d: invalid mapaddr %s\n",
- prog, lineno, (char *)dbuf.mv_data+STRLENOF("mapaddr="));
- exit(EXIT_FAILURE);
- }
- } else if (!strncmp(dbuf.mv_data, "mapsize=", STRLENOF("mapsize="))) {
- int i;
- ptr = memchr(dbuf.mv_data, '\n', dbuf.mv_size);
- if (ptr) *ptr = '\0';
- i = sscanf((char *)dbuf.mv_data+STRLENOF("mapsize="), "%" Z "u", &info.me_mapsize);
- if (i != 1) {
- fprintf(stderr, "%s: line %" Z "d: invalid mapsize %s\n",
- prog, lineno, (char *)dbuf.mv_data+STRLENOF("mapsize="));
- exit(EXIT_FAILURE);
- }
- } else if (!strncmp(dbuf.mv_data, "maxreaders=", STRLENOF("maxreaders="))) {
- int i;
- ptr = memchr(dbuf.mv_data, '\n', dbuf.mv_size);
- if (ptr) *ptr = '\0';
- i = sscanf((char *)dbuf.mv_data+STRLENOF("maxreaders="), "%u", &info.me_maxreaders);
- if (i != 1) {
- fprintf(stderr, "%s: line %" Z "d: invalid maxreaders %s\n",
- prog, lineno, (char *)dbuf.mv_data+STRLENOF("maxreaders="));
- exit(EXIT_FAILURE);
- }
- } else {
- int i;
- for (i=0; dbflags[i].bit; i++) {
- if (!strncmp(dbuf.mv_data, dbflags[i].name, dbflags[i].len) &&
- ((char *)dbuf.mv_data)[dbflags[i].len] == '=') {
- flags |= dbflags[i].bit;
- break;
- }
- }
- if (!dbflags[i].bit) {
- ptr = memchr(dbuf.mv_data, '=', dbuf.mv_size);
- if (!ptr) {
- fprintf(stderr, "%s: line %" Z "d: unexpected format\n",
- prog, lineno);
- exit(EXIT_FAILURE);
- } else {
- *ptr = '\0';
- fprintf(stderr, "%s: line %" Z "d: unrecognized keyword ignored: %s\n",
- prog, lineno, (char *)dbuf.mv_data);
- }
- }
- }
- }
- }
- static void badend(void)
- {
- fprintf(stderr, "%s: line %" Z "d: unexpected end of input\n",
- prog, lineno);
- }
- static int unhex(unsigned char *c2)
- {
- int x, c;
- x = *c2++ & 0x4f;
- if (x & 0x40)
- x -= 55;
- c = x << 4;
- x = *c2 & 0x4f;
- if (x & 0x40)
- x -= 55;
- c |= x;
- return c;
- }
- static int readline(MDB_val *out, MDB_val *buf)
- {
- unsigned char *c1, *c2, *end;
- size_t len, l2;
- int c;
- if (!(mode & NOHDR)) {
- c = fgetc(stdin);
- if (c == EOF) {
- Eof = 1;
- return EOF;
- }
- if (c != ' ') {
- lineno++;
- if (fgets(buf->mv_data, buf->mv_size, stdin) == NULL) {
- badend:
- Eof = 1;
- badend();
- return EOF;
- }
- if (c == 'D' && !strncmp(buf->mv_data, "ATA=END", STRLENOF("ATA=END")))
- return EOF;
- goto badend;
- }
- }
- if (fgets(buf->mv_data, buf->mv_size, stdin) == NULL) {
- Eof = 1;
- return EOF;
- }
- lineno++;
- c1 = buf->mv_data;
- len = strlen((char *)c1);
- l2 = len;
- /* Is buffer too short? */
- while (c1[len-1] != '\n') {
- buf->mv_data = realloc(buf->mv_data, buf->mv_size*2);
- if (!buf->mv_data) {
- Eof = 1;
- fprintf(stderr, "%s: line %" Z "d: out of memory, line too long\n",
- prog, lineno);
- return EOF;
- }
- c1 = buf->mv_data;
- c1 += l2;
- if (fgets((char *)c1, buf->mv_size+1, stdin) == NULL) {
- Eof = 1;
- badend();
- return EOF;
- }
- buf->mv_size *= 2;
- len = strlen((char *)c1);
- l2 += len;
- }
- c1 = c2 = buf->mv_data;
- len = l2;
- c1[--len] = '\0';
- end = c1 + len;
- if (mode & PRINT) {
- while (c2 < end) {
- if (*c2 == '\\') {
- if (c2[1] == '\\') {
- *c1++ = *c2;
- } else {
- if (c2+3 > end || !isxdigit(c2[1]) || !isxdigit(c2[2])) {
- Eof = 1;
- badend();
- return EOF;
- }
- *c1++ = unhex(++c2);
- }
- c2 += 2;
- } else {
- /* copies are redundant when no escapes were used */
- *c1++ = *c2++;
- }
- }
- } else {
- /* odd length not allowed */
- if (len & 1) {
- Eof = 1;
- badend();
- return EOF;
- }
- while (c2 < end) {
- if (!isxdigit(*c2) || !isxdigit(c2[1])) {
- Eof = 1;
- badend();
- return EOF;
- }
- *c1++ = unhex(c2);
- c2 += 2;
- }
- }
- c2 = out->mv_data = buf->mv_data;
- out->mv_size = c1 - c2;
- return 0;
- }
- static void usage(void)
- {
- fprintf(stderr, "usage: %s [-V] [-a] [-f input] [-n] [-s name] [-N] [-T] dbpath\n", prog);
- exit(EXIT_FAILURE);
- }
- static int greater(const MDB_val *a, const MDB_val *b)
- {
- return 1;
- }
- int main(int argc, char *argv[])
- {
- int i, rc;
- MDB_env *env;
- MDB_txn *txn;
- MDB_cursor *mc;
- MDB_dbi dbi;
- char *envname;
- int envflags = MDB_NOSYNC, putflags = 0;
- int dohdr = 0, append = 0;
- MDB_val prevk;
- prog = argv[0];
- if (argc < 2) {
- usage();
- }
- /* -a: append records in input order
- * -f: load file instead of stdin
- * -n: use NOSUBDIR flag on env_open
- * -s: load into named subDB
- * -N: use NOOVERWRITE on puts
- * -T: read plaintext
- * -V: print version and exit
- */
- while ((i = getopt(argc, argv, "af:ns:NTV")) != EOF) {
- switch(i) {
- case 'V':
- printf("%s\n", MDB_VERSION_STRING);
- exit(0);
- break;
- case 'a':
- append = 1;
- break;
- case 'f':
- if (freopen(optarg, "r", stdin) == NULL) {
- fprintf(stderr, "%s: %s: reopen: %s\n",
- prog, optarg, strerror(errno));
- exit(EXIT_FAILURE);
- }
- break;
- case 'n':
- envflags |= MDB_NOSUBDIR;
- break;
- case 's':
- subname = strdup(optarg);
- break;
- case 'N':
- putflags = MDB_NOOVERWRITE|MDB_NODUPDATA;
- break;
- case 'T':
- mode |= NOHDR | PRINT;
- break;
- default:
- usage();
- }
- }
- if (optind != argc - 1)
- usage();
- dbuf.mv_size = 4096;
- dbuf.mv_data = malloc(dbuf.mv_size);
- if (!(mode & NOHDR))
- readhdr();
- envname = argv[optind];
- rc = mdb_env_create(&env);
- if (rc) {
- fprintf(stderr, "mdb_env_create failed, error %d %s\n", rc, mdb_strerror(rc));
- return EXIT_FAILURE;
- }
- mdb_env_set_maxdbs(env, 2);
- if (info.me_maxreaders)
- mdb_env_set_maxreaders(env, info.me_maxreaders);
- if (info.me_mapsize)
- mdb_env_set_mapsize(env, info.me_mapsize);
- if (info.me_mapaddr)
- envflags |= MDB_FIXEDMAP;
- rc = mdb_env_open(env, envname, envflags, 0664);
- if (rc) {
- fprintf(stderr, "mdb_env_open failed, error %d %s\n", rc, mdb_strerror(rc));
- goto env_close;
- }
- kbuf.mv_size = mdb_env_get_maxkeysize(env) * 2 + 2;
- kbuf.mv_data = malloc(kbuf.mv_size * 2);
- k0buf.mv_size = kbuf.mv_size;
- k0buf.mv_data = (char *)kbuf.mv_data + kbuf.mv_size;
- prevk.mv_data = k0buf.mv_data;
- while(!Eof) {
- MDB_val key, data;
- int batch = 0;
- flags = 0;
- int appflag;
- if (!dohdr) {
- dohdr = 1;
- } else if (!(mode & NOHDR))
- readhdr();
-
- rc = mdb_txn_begin(env, NULL, 0, &txn);
- if (rc) {
- fprintf(stderr, "mdb_txn_begin failed, error %d %s\n", rc, mdb_strerror(rc));
- goto env_close;
- }
- rc = mdb_open(txn, subname, flags|MDB_CREATE, &dbi);
- if (rc) {
- fprintf(stderr, "mdb_open failed, error %d %s\n", rc, mdb_strerror(rc));
- goto txn_abort;
- }
- prevk.mv_size = 0;
- if (append) {
- mdb_set_compare(txn, dbi, greater);
- if (flags & MDB_DUPSORT)
- mdb_set_dupsort(txn, dbi, greater);
- }
- rc = mdb_cursor_open(txn, dbi, &mc);
- if (rc) {
- fprintf(stderr, "mdb_cursor_open failed, error %d %s\n", rc, mdb_strerror(rc));
- goto txn_abort;
- }
- while(1) {
- rc = readline(&key, &kbuf);
- if (rc) /* rc == EOF */
- break;
- rc = readline(&data, &dbuf);
- if (rc) {
- fprintf(stderr, "%s: line %" Z "d: failed to read key value\n", prog, lineno);
- goto txn_abort;
- }
- if (append) {
- appflag = MDB_APPEND;
- if (flags & MDB_DUPSORT) {
- if (prevk.mv_size == key.mv_size && !memcmp(prevk.mv_data, key.mv_data, key.mv_size))
- appflag = MDB_CURRENT|MDB_APPENDDUP;
- else {
- memcpy(prevk.mv_data, key.mv_data, key.mv_size);
- prevk.mv_size = key.mv_size;
- }
- }
- } else {
- appflag = 0;
- }
- rc = mdb_cursor_put(mc, &key, &data, putflags|appflag);
- if (rc == MDB_KEYEXIST && putflags)
- continue;
- if (rc) {
- fprintf(stderr, "mdb_cursor_put failed, error %d %s\n", rc, mdb_strerror(rc));
- goto txn_abort;
- }
- batch++;
- if (batch == 100) {
- rc = mdb_txn_commit(txn);
- if (rc) {
- fprintf(stderr, "%s: line %" Z "d: txn_commit: %s\n",
- prog, lineno, mdb_strerror(rc));
- goto env_close;
- }
- rc = mdb_txn_begin(env, NULL, 0, &txn);
- if (rc) {
- fprintf(stderr, "mdb_txn_begin failed, error %d %s\n", rc, mdb_strerror(rc));
- goto env_close;
- }
- rc = mdb_cursor_open(txn, dbi, &mc);
- if (rc) {
- fprintf(stderr, "mdb_cursor_open failed, error %d %s\n", rc, mdb_strerror(rc));
- goto txn_abort;
- }
- if (appflag & MDB_APPENDDUP) {
- MDB_val k, d;
- mdb_cursor_get(mc, &k, &d, MDB_LAST);
- }
- batch = 0;
- }
- }
- rc = mdb_txn_commit(txn);
- txn = NULL;
- if (rc) {
- fprintf(stderr, "%s: line %" Z "d: txn_commit: %s\n",
- prog, lineno, mdb_strerror(rc));
- goto env_close;
- }
- mdb_dbi_close(env, dbi);
- }
- txn_abort:
- mdb_txn_abort(txn);
- env_close:
- mdb_env_close(env);
- return rc ? EXIT_FAILURE : EXIT_SUCCESS;
- }
